Subject: Goods lift — night deliveries

Hi all,

The goods lift at Marwick Point is reserved for deliveries between 22:00 and 06:00. Night shift staff should not use it for general movement during this window; take the east stairwell instead. Couriers must be escorted at all times. To call the lift for a delivery, use the code below.

badge for yajep-tawip: bdg-UBYAH-39947

Handover — request tracing, Quillhook stack

New folks: every request gets a trace ID at the Doorstep gateway. Services forward it via rq-trace-id. If a span is missing, it's almost always the legacy Coupon service; it drops headers on 302s. Dashboards live in the Glasspane tool under team Otterline. Don't touch sampling config without telling Marek. Collector restarts require the vault unlock; the recovery passphrase you need for that is listed below.

unlock words, hahip-baduf: holwyn-istath-julvan

Onboarding note for the Ledgerpane admin table: bulk edits are applied through the batcher service, not directly against the database. Select rows, choose an action, and the batcher stages changes in a pending set you can review before commit. Edits over 500 rows require a second approver — this is enforced server-side, so don't try to chunk around it. To run the batcher locally you need the staging write credential, which goes in your .env as the next line.

secret setting of bahip-kagag: RELAY_SECRET3=c83